A downstairs toilet can be a valuable addition to your home, providing convenience and privacy. However, these spaces are often compact, which can make designing a functional and stylish bathroom challenging. Don't worry! With clever planning and some creative ideas, bathroom downstairs you can transform even the smallest downstairs toilet into a welcoming and efficient space.
- Consider incorporating a corner sink to maximize floor space.
- Go up, not out by adding shelves or cabinets for storage.
- Opt for a pedestal sink to free up valuable room.
- Choose a bright color palette to make the space feel larger and more airy.
